Do you believe in life on other planets? If so, do you think they live among us? Well, a man near Berwick, Louisiana claimed that his friend captured this image of an alien in the wreckage of his trail cam. Fortunately, the SIM card wasn't damaged or we'd never have known about this thing's existence. But is it an alien or a hoax?